56 Gbps NRZ (Non-Return-to-Zero) is a binary code using low and high signal levels to represent 1/0 information of digital logic signal. NRZ can only transmit 1 bit, i.e., a 0 or 1, of information per signal symbol period. The goal of NRZ is to transmit bytes of data over coax, fiber, or a PCB trace. NRZ signals have a higher Nyquist frequency, which is the bandwidth of a sampled signal, it is equal to half the sampling frequency of the signal. APF6/APM6 AcceleRate® HP High-Performance Arrays

Features

  • 0.635 mm (.025”) pitch
  • Performance up to 56 Gbps NRZ / 112 Gbps PAM4
  • Cost-optimized solution
  • Low profile 5 mm and up to 10 mm stack heights
  • Up to 400 total pins available; roadmap to 1,000+ pins
  • Open-pin-field design for grounding and routing flexibility
  • PCIe® Gen 5 and 100 GbE compatible

NVAF/NVAM NovaRay® Extreme Density Arrays

Features

  • 0.80 mm (0.0315”) pitch
  • Performance up to 56 Gbps NRZ / 112 Gbps PAM4
  • 7 and 10 mm stack heights
  • 2, 3 or 4 rows
  • 1 or 2 banks with up to 16 pairs/bank
  • Two points of contact ensure a more reliable connection
  • Minimal variance in data rate as stack height increases
